    Abstract: Systems and methods provide for authenticating a user attempting to make a payment using a piezoelectric device are disclosed herein. In an embodiment, the piezoelectric device can be embedded on a credit card, debit card, or other form of payment card and signals generated by the piezoelectric device can be used to authenticate the user when making the payment. For example, the user can squeeze or manipulate the piezoelectric device in a specific predetermined pattern and the resulting electric charge or induced current generated by the piezoelectric device can facilitate transmitting a signal to a point of sale device, and the point of sale device can authenticate the user based on the signal. In other embodiments, the piezoelectric device can contain circuitry and/or logic that can authenticate the user and send a confirmation signal to the point of sale device to authenticate the payment.

    Abstract: This technology relates to providing a web-based digital claims platform to provide users with a simple and customized experience when filing insurance claims. The platform is enabled by a plurality of back-end application programming interface (API) resources. These API resources are event-driven (e.g., when an “event” associated with the claim occurs, the status of the claim changes and the API is provided with updated information indicative of the change). The platform includes a customized user interface (UI) that tailors the claim experience to a particular user's needs. The customization can be based off of stated user preferences and/or learned user preferences associated with the user's past behavior. A user can perform/request various services through the customized UI's self-service function (e.g., rent a car, find a hotel room, select a repair shop, etc.). Additionally, the customized UI can enable the user upload documents, track claim status, find relevant help topics, etc.

    Abstract: A steering system for a snowmobile includes a handlebar assembly and a steering column that has an upper end coupled to the handlebar assembly. An electronic steering assist unit is coupled to the steering column between upper and lower posts of the steering column. A steering arm assembly is coupled to a lower end of the lower post. First and second tie rods respectively couple the steering arm assembly to first and second ski assemblies such that turning the handlebar assembly, together with the assistance of the electronic steering assist unit, causes the ski assemblies to pivot. A floating mounting system couples the electronic steering assist unit to forward spars of the frame assembly to prevent a torque pre-load on the electronic steering assist unit. The steering column and the electronic steering assist unit share a common axis of rotation that is positioned along a centerline of the snowmobile.

    Abstract: The technology relates to detecting and responding to emergency vehicles. This may include using a plurality of microphones to detect a siren noise corresponding to an emergency vehicle and to estimate a bearing of the emergency vehicle. This estimated bearing is compared to map information to identify a portion of roadway on which the emergency vehicle is traveling. In addition, information identifying a set of objects in the vehicle's environment as well as characteristics of those objects is received from a perception system is used to determine whether one of the set of objects corresponds to the emergency vehicle. How to respond to the emergency vehicle is determined based on the estimated bearing and identified road segments and the determination of whether one of the set of objects corresponds to the emergency vehicle. This determined response is then used to control the vehicle in an autonomous driving mode.
